State three ways in which quartz and plagioclase feldspar are similar.

Feldspar is the same arrangement of atoms, a framework arrangement, and one basic chemical recipe, a silicate recipe.
Quartz is another framework silicate, consisting only of oxygen and silicon, but feldspar has various other metals partly replacing the silicon.
